Summary
The Senior I&C Engineer is responsible for leading the design, engineering, and integration of instrumentation and control systems for FPSO/FSO/FPU/FSRU/CPP projects. This role ensures that instrumentation deliverables meet project specifications, industry standards, and client requirements across all project phases from FEED to commissioning.
Responsibilities
- Develop and review instrumentation and control system designs, including datasheets, specifications, I/O lists, instrument index, cause & effect charts, cable schedule, hook-up drawing, loop diagrams and control philosophies/narratives.
- Ensure compliance with IEC, ISA, API, and international standards, as well as classification society requirements.
- Conduct instrument sizing and selection (flow, pressure, temperature, level, analyzers, transmitters, control valves).
- Support control system architecture design (DCS, ESD, F&G, PLCs, SCADA systems). Review and interface with vendors.
- Review P&ID, 3Dmodelling.
- Support procurement activities including TBE, vendor clarification and FAT/SAT.
- Support site activities including installation, testing, commissioning, and troubleshooting as required.
- Provide technical guidance and mentoring to junior I&C engineers.
- Coordinate with multidisciplinary teams (Process, Mechanical, HVAC, Electrical, Telecom, Piping, Safety etc.,)
- Participate in HAZOP, SIL, LOPA and risk assessments.
- Assigned as I&C lead in project as required.
Requirements
- Bachelor's degree in Instrumentation, Control, Electronics, or Electrical Engineering (or equivalent).
- Minimum 8-12 years instrumentation engineering experience in the oil & gas / FPSO / EPC industry.
- Prior offshore or shipyard experience
- Professional certification or TUV Function Safety certification
- Proficient in instrumentation engineering tools such as SPI (SmartPlant Instrumentation/INtools).
- Strong knowledge of control system logic, I/O configuration, and integration.
- Skilled in instrument sizing calculations and selection for oil & gas applications.
- Familiarity with SIL classification, reliability, and functional safety requirements.
- Excellent written and communications skills.
